Nearby locations
Benbow, Virginia, United States
Mount Gate, Virginia, United States
Criggers, Virginia, United States
Nearby popular places
Wynne Peak, United States
Battle Knob, United States
Steel Hill, United States

Weather Radar in Benbow, Virginia, United States

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.